Andrew Velázquez starred for Santurce, going 3-for-3 with a double, three runs scored and a walk. By THE STAR STAFF The Santurce Crabbers mounted a five-run rally in the second inning and went on to defeat the Ponce Lions 8-2 on Tuesday night at Hiram Bithorn Stadium in Hato Rey to take a 2-0 lead in the Roberto Clemente Professional Baseball League finals.
